About imidazo[4,5-c]pyridin-1-ium

imidazo[4,5-c]pyridin-1-ium (PubChem CID 88684624) has the molecular formula C6H4N3+ and a molecular weight of 118.12 g/mol. Its IUPAC name is imidazo[4,5-c]pyridin-1-ium.
